  • Patent number: 6540187
    Abstract: The bracket includes an inner body having a hook on one end and arranged to slide within an outer body having a hook on one end to provide a variable bracket length. A pair of springs located between overlapping portions of the bodies biases the bracket towards its longer uncompressed length. After the bracket is mounted to a support surface, a wall of the headrail is hooked onto the hook of the inner body. The headrail is then advanced to compress the springs and shorten the bracket length so that an opposite wall of the headrail can catch on the hook of the outer body. Removing the compression force on the springs biases the bracket toward its longer length to capture the second wall of the headrail with the hook of the outer body. By this arrangement, an easily applied pushing force installs and attaches the mounting bracket to the headrail.

  • Patent number: 6540188
    Abstract: A mounting arrangement includes a multi-functional arm mounted in a mounting receiver. The arm includes a forward enlarged section, an intermediate recessed section, and a rearward enlarged section. The mounting receiver includes a forward mounting portion, an intermediate open portion, and a rearward mounting portion. The arm is mounted by aligning the intermediate recessed section of the arm over a top opening in the forward mounting portion, lowering the arm and sliding it rearwardly. A pair of pins on the arm engage a pair of aligned apertures on the front surface of the forward mounting portion to minimize looseness between the arm and the mounting receiver. A latch mechanism engages the arm to secure the arm in the mounting receiver and provides a visual indication that the arm is properly engaged. When the latch mechanism is pivoted by an operator inwardly, the latch mechanism disengages the arm, allowing removal of the arm from the mounting receiver.

  • Patent number: 6540193
    Abstract: A rearview mirror mounting assembly comprises a mounting arm which is pivotally secured to a mounting base and may be further pivotally attached to an accessory or an interior rearview mirror. The mounting arm comprises a ball receiving portion for receiving and pivotally engaging a ball member on the mounting base. The ball receiving portion tightly engages the ball member in response to a biasing force exerted on the ball receiving socket by a biasing member within the mounting arm. The biasing member is aligned and guided within the mounting arm via at least one confinement member, such as an annular guide portion, extending longitudinally within the arm and surrounding at least one substantially flat or planar surface, which the biasing member engages. Preferably, one of the surfaces is rigidly secured to the arm, thereby reducing potential vibration between the arm and the interior rearview mirror.

  • Patent number: 6540198
    Abstract: A docking station (10) comprises a mast latch assembly (12) which attaches to the outer end of a mast (M). An adapter (14) which connects to a sensor platform (G) disengagingly attaches to the mast latch assembly. An isolation assembly (16) mounts on a surface (D) of a vehicle (V) adjacent an opening (O) through which the mast extends and retracts. As the mast is retracted, the adapter (14) engages with isolation assembly (16) and disengages from the mast latch assembly. This attaches the sensor platform to the isolation assembly which now protects the sensors from vibrations produced by the vehicle and any shocks created by the terrain over which the vehicle travels. It also allows the sensors to be used for surveillance during vehicle travel. When the vehicle stops and the mast is again extended, the adapter (14) re-engages with the mast latch assembly and is disengaged from the isolation assembly.

  • Patent number: 6540204
    Abstract: An improved electrically operated pilot-type, “instant-on” solenoid assembly for near-instantaneous control over the flow of compressed gas. The assembly may be applied in fuel systems for propulsion in vehicles using gaseous fuel. It includes a housing with inlet and outlet passages connected to a primary chamber where a primary piston is slidably mounted, a secondary chamber having a secondary piston slidably mounted within the chamber, a solenoid to produce translational movement of the pilot piston, and passageways linking the various components. When the solenoid is energized, the pilot piston is moved to permit fluid to flow from the primary to the pilot chamber, producing an increase in the differential pressure in the regions of the primary chamber. The differential pressure then forces the primary piston to move, exposing the outlet to fluid flow from the gas inlet.

  • Patent number: 6540208
    Abstract: A method for installing and/or removing a cable (300) in conduits (500) for the passage of cables and to an associated implementing device. According to this method, a current of water is conveyed inside the conduits (500), the cable (300) to be installed has a conduit fill rate that can attain 90%, and the conduits (500) form a winding course on a length greater than 2000 m. This method is chiefly characterized in that the cable (300) is subjected to a thrust force that drives its speed of progression (v), and in that said thrust force and the pressure of the water flowing in the conduits are regulated so as to maintain a constant water flow rate inside the conduits (500).

  • Patent number: 6540212
    Abstract: A fuel needle valve assembly of a carburetor has a retainer which yieldingly restrains the rotational fuel flow setting capability of the needle valve. The retainer engages a shank of the needle valve and a parallel shaft, both of which project from the carburetor body. The retainer exerts a force which laterally displaces the projecting shank with respect to the shaft. The retainer has sufficient strength to ensure the factory set rotational setting of the fuel needle valve does not alter when a limiter cap is press fitted to a distal head of the needle. Furthermore, wherein the shaft is also a shank of a second needle valve, the same retainer laterally displaces the projecting shanks of both needle valves.

  • Patent number: 6540228
    Abstract: A method and system for playing a casino style card game, referred to as “Go Fish 21,” in conjunction with standard rules for Blackjack, using a shoe of five or six standard decks of cards and a special set of 14 Go Fish playing cards. These 14 cards, which include standard cards valued 3-10, Jack, Queen, King, and Ace, along with 2 Jokers, are placed face down prior to play of the game. In conjunction with standard Blackjack play, prior to dealing any cards, the players optionally place a selection for play of Go Fish 21, including wager, to receive a special bonus card in the event that the participating player is dealt a “Blackjack” hand. Upon a “Blackjack” hand being dealt to a player selecting to play Go Fish 21, that player selects one of the remaining Go Fish cards. A payout is made based on the card.

  • Patent number: 6540230
    Abstract: A method and apparatus of playing a card game such as Blackjack provides a player with at least one additional option for playing the card game. For example, a Blackjack player who has made an initial bet and was dealt an unfavorable starting hand may be provided with at least one additional option, such as making a bust insurance bet or mortgaging a round of play. If the player makes a bust insurance bet, he will receive a payout if he then busts upon drawing an additional card. If the player selects a mortgaging option, he agrees to play the current round of play or at least one future round of play in accordance with a revised rule that is unfavorable for the player in exchange for receiving an advantage during the current round of play.

  • Patent number: 6540234
    Abstract: A gasket (10; 40; 50; 70) comprises a sealing member which forms a closed loop extending around a hole. The sealing member is formed from resilient metal and has a transverse cross section which is generally X-shaped and comprises two arms (12, 14) which project inwardly of the hole, and two arms (16, 18) which project outwardly of the hole. The inwardly projecting arms form a first seal around said hole, and the outwardly projecting arms form a second seal around said hole. Each arm extends from a junction (22) with the remainder of the gasket to a tip (24) of the arm which engages one of the bodies. Each arm has its greatest thickness at said junction (22) and its smallest thickness at a point adjacent to or at said tip (24), the arm continuously reducing in thickness between said junction and said point. The gasket can yield from the tips of the arms inwardly as the pressure on the gasket increases.

  • Patent number: 6540236
    Abstract: A chuck includes a generally cylindrical body having a nose section and a tail section. A plurality of jaws are movably disposed with respect to the body to and away from the chuck's axial bore. A generally cylindrical sleeve is in driving communication with the jaws. The sleeve engages the body or the jaws by a first set of interengaged threads so that relative rotation between the first threads drives the jaws toward or away from the chuck axis. The sleeve engages the body or the jaws by a second set of interengaged threads so that relative rotation between the second threads drives the jaws toward or away from the chuck axis. The first thread set defines a first pitch so that when the jaws close, the first threads rotationally lock in the closing direction. The second thread set defines a second pitch that is higher than the first pitch so that when the jaws close, the second threads are relatively rotatable in the closing direction.
